Challenge
The candidate is expected to supervise M.A.Sc., M.Sc. and Ph.D. students and professional and technical research staff.
This position can lead to a permanent position as assistant professor or a more senior level.
Current activity in the nuclear field includes: nuclear fuel engineering, nuclear fuel management, nuclear reactor materials, novel techniques of radiation dosimetry, reactor instrumentation and control, nuclear reactor design, non-destructive testing, neutron activation analysis and radiochemistry, nuclear counter-terrorism, radiological contamination and remediation, and nuclear waste management. The Department operates a SLOWPOKE-2 nuclear research reactor.
